RADARSAT-2 DInSAR and GNSS-Derived Finite Fault Model of the 2012 Mw 7.8 Haida Gwaii Earthquake
The Mw 7.8 Haida Gwaii earthquake occurred on 28 October 2012, generating up to 13 m tsunami waves and 3 m run-up along the British Columbia coastline. Despite the magnitude of the earthquake and tsunami, damages were minor due to the lack of vulnerable infrastructure in the remote area. Previous fi...
